Subject: DR Drill Report — Config Hot-Reload Path

For your review: during Tuesday's disaster-recovery drill at Fennick Systems, we exercised the hot-reload path for the Corvane service configuration. Reload signals were authenticated, audit-logged, and applied without restart; rollback completed in under four seconds. No unauthorized values were accepted. Should you need to unlock the drill artifacts vault, enter the passphrase below.

vault phrase of kafog-kahif = holdor-rusir-praox

## Deployment

The Pellmere queue-depth autoscaler runs as a single replica in the ops namespace and polls the Brinewatch broker every 15 seconds. It scales worker pods between fixed lower and upper bounds, never touching other workloads. All scaling decisions are logged and signed for audit review. Credentials are mounted read-only from the cluster secret store; the autoscaler itself holds no long-lived tokens. For review purposes, the deployment applies the following configuration values at startup.

config for bahop-fajep:
DRUATH_PIN=4501
DRUATH_TENANT=briwyn
DRUATH_METRICS_HOST=metrics.druath.brasksoft.test
DRUATH_SEAL=seal_7d2e069d
DRUATH_STANDBY_TEAM=olieth

Action item (P1, owner: Tavener team): the bloom filter fronting the Kestrel KV store drifted after the resize in the Moreno deploy, causing false negatives and direct-store hammering. Rebuild filter on deploy, add a drift metric, and gate releases on it. Do not ship 4.12 until the gate is green. Rebuild procedure and sizing calculator are documented on the internal page below.

wiki page, bagaf-fawip: https://harbor.tolvaqsys.local/pages/repo/pages/secrets/eac969ffc71f356b